Not Installing Your Dishwasher Appropriately Can Bring About a Hill of Troubles


Not just can setting up a dishwasher correctly void your service warranty, but it can additionally create a mess. If you inaccurately install your dishwashing machine to the garbage disposal, you might discover pungent scents or have deposit on your dishes.

An Improper Installation Can Invalidate the Dishwashing machine's Guarantee


Prior to setting up a dishwashing machine on your own, you ought to check out the service warranty very carefully. Also a little harming the dish washer during the installation process can nullify the warranty. Because the expense of a dishwashing machine ranges in between $300 to $1,000 as well as upwards, that can be a costly mistake. Even if the dishwashing machine still works, you will not be able to change it needs to it damage quickly. So, unless you come in handy and also have experience mounting dishwashing machines, you must work with a plumber so you do not risk your warranty.

Setting Up a Dishwashing Machine Calls For a Range of Tools


If you do not have a variety of tools on hand, you might need to make a trip to Lowe's or House Depot. To install a dishwasher, you require the following devices: pliers, a flexible w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and opening saws.

A Plumber Can Evaluate the Supply Lines


A supply line, specifically a dishwashing machine connector, attaches the dishwashing machine to a water source. If you purchase a brand-new supply line, a plumber can make sure that the line is compatible with both your dish washer and water resource. If you decide to use an existing supply line, an expert plumber can check it to ensure that it remains in good condition as well as does not have any leaks.

PLUMBING SERVICES YOU'LL NEED FOR A KITCHEN REMODEL


S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ION


If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.


If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
